diff options
| author | Matt Arsenault <Matthew.Arsenault@amd.com> | 2019-02-08 02:40:47 +0000 |
|---|---|---|
| committer | Matt Arsenault <Matthew.Arsenault@amd.com> | 2019-02-08 02:40:47 +0000 |
| commit | a8b4339c2f3992f94d25c61a4841c7bedff17964 (patch) | |
| tree | 4907db80d3a9d52b3aa134ac46c411deb723dc0f /llvm/lib/CodeGen | |
| parent | 0d9f3f7f953e61534d7ba9e94ae579ac854fdeae (diff) | |
| download | bcm5719-llvm-a8b4339c2f3992f94d25c61a4841c7bedff17964.tar.gz bcm5719-llvm-a8b4339c2f3992f94d25c61a4841c7bedff17964.zip | |
AMDGPU/GlobalISel: Legalize addrspacecast
Use a placeholder constant for now on targets
that need the load from the queue ptr.
llvm-svn: 353497
Diffstat (limited to 'llvm/lib/CodeGen')
| -rw-r--r-- | llvm/lib/CodeGen/GlobalISel/LegalizerHelper.cpp |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/llvm/lib/CodeGen/GlobalISel/LegalizerHelper.cpp b/llvm/lib/CodeGen/GlobalISel/LegalizerHelper.cpp index ff5b18a5a76..b01cb27bfad 100644 --- a/llvm/lib/CodeGen/GlobalISel/LegalizerHelper.cpp +++ b/llvm/lib/CodeGen/GlobalISel/LegalizerHelper.cpp @@ -2174,6 +2174,7 @@ LegalizerHelper::fewerElementsVector(MachineInstr &MI, unsigned TypeIdx, case G_FPTOUI: case G_INTTOPTR: case G_PTRTOINT: + case G_ADDRSPACE_CAST: return fewerElementsVectorCasts(MI, TypeIdx, NarrowTy); case G_ICMP: case G_FCMP: |

